Richardson’s artwork featured in Astrovitae magazine
Gabe Richardson, recent Meeker High School graduate, began his art career very early and is currently majoring in art with an emphasis on education at Colorado Mesa University. Kracht’s linoleum block print to advance to NYC competition
MEEKER I Meeker High School senior Sarah Kracht was recently selected for a Gold Key award in the Scholastic Art & Writing Awards competition that recognizes the work of exemplary high school students. MHS ARTISTS …
Meeker High School’s art program had another incredible year at the Colorado Regional Scholastic Art Awards, receiving nine awards overall; five Silver Keys and four Honorable Mentions. Art instructor tackles mural project
MEEKER | Ben Quinn, art teacher at Meeker High School, has recently taken on a project at the Meeker Recreation Center to create a mural on the north wall of the natatorium. The mural depicts a giant shipwreck surrounded by the creatures of the ocean. It’s located behind the slide to[Read More…]
